About ZIP code 86047
The housing stock consists of predominantly single-family detached homes. Most homes were built in the 1970s, giving the area an established character. Median home value is $111,300. Owner-occupancy sits near the national average at 61%.
Median household income is $45,842. Poverty affects 30% of residents, above the national average. SNAP benefit usage at 28% of households reflects economic stress in the area.
The dominant occupation class is service, with education and healthcare as the leading industry. The average commute of 24 minutes is near the national average.
College attainment at 7% is below the national average, consistent with a trades and production-oriented local economy.
Health indicators show elevated rates of smoking (24%) compared to national benchmarks.
Overall, ZIP code 86047 reflects a community defined by a trades-oriented workforce, economic challenges above the national average, and elevated reliance on food assistance.
